Heegner cycles and p-adic L-functions
Abstract
In this paper, we deduce the vanishing of Selmer groups for the Rankin-Selberg convolution of a cusp form with a theta series of higher weight from the nonvanishing of the associated L-value, thus establishing the rank 0 case of the Bloch-Kato conjecture in these cases. Our methods are based on the connection between Heegner cycles and p-adic L-functions, building upon recent work of Bertolini, Darmon and Prasanna, and on an extension of Kolyvagin's method of Euler systems to the anticyclotomic setting. In the course of the proof, we also obtain a higher weight analogue of Mazur's conjecture (as proven in weight 2 by Cornut-Vatsal), and as a consequence of our results, we deduce from Nekovar's work a proof of the parity conjecture in this setting.
